如何对数据库某个字段进行语义分析?并把分析结果显示在一个新列上。
比如:牙疼1周 和 牙疼3周 分析结果应该都是'牙疼' ,这只是一个简单的举例而已。
这个技术少说值几百万吧.
百度搜语义分析的库或服务直接用吧.
你好 能推荐下吗?我百度了好久了没找到
@.NET_海: 百度不是挺多的.或者直接用盘古分词.
@吴瑞祥: 盘古分词是把自己输入的一句话进行解析成所有的词,然后存下来。当下次输入含有相同词时提示。我考虑过盘古分词,好像觉得这不是我要的需求!!我现在要分析数据库的字段值,把分析结果直接在新列上显示出来,然后对分析结果的新列做进一步处理。您觉得我这样的需求盘古分词适合用吗?望指导下
@.NET_海: 那你这个分析的规则能写出来吗?
@吴瑞祥: 目前我也迷茫中......,不知道如何下手
@.NET_海: 所以说你的问题是:你不知道要做什么.而不是你不知道要怎么做.
这个谁都帮不了你.
提示:所谓的语义分析.计算机能做的事情就是:分词+权重.给提取出来的每个词加个权重.以表示这个词的重要性.百度搜语义分析.我记得有个大学的项目.可以在线看效果.你调他的接口就行.
@吴瑞祥: 那我找找看看。非常感谢!